Our Assessment

Strong automation pressure

  • Documenting progress and program updates Important 63%

    Progress documentation is one of the more structured workflows around exercise care.

Mixed

  • Developing individualized exercise programs Core 43%

    Program support is strong, but safe patient-specific prescription still requires human oversight.

  • Interpreting participant data to adjust programs Core 48%

    Data analysis support is useful, but program changes still need expert judgment.

Human advantage

  • Demonstrating exercise routines and equipment use Core 21%

    Demonstration and correction remain live physical coaching tasks.

  • Providing clinical oversight during exercise sessions Core 17%

    Supervision during exercise remains patient-facing and liability-heavy.

  • Explaining testing and exercise procedures to participants Important 29%

    Patient instruction and reassurance remain strongly interpersonal.

  • Recommending lifestyle physical activity changes Important 37%

    Behavior-change guidance can be supported, but adherence coaching remains human-led.

  • Handling physical distress and emergency response Important 8%

    Emergency response in exercise settings remains extremely low-automation.

Market Check

Demand Growing

Demand remains healthy because cardiac rehab performance and wellness programs still support the occupation, and the BLS outlook is stronger than average.

Competition Balanced

Competition looks moderate because the field is specialized, while stronger sports-performance and hospital roles still draw more attention than the raw title pool suggests.

Entry Access Mixed

Entry access remains workable because clinical and wellness feeder routes remain visible, even if the market is narrower than larger rehab professions.

Search Friction Stable

The search should feel selective but real because demand exists, while employer type and certification expectations still shape where openings feel strongest.

BLS + karpathy/jobs (digital AI exposure) 40%

The role involves a significant amount of physical presence, including conducting stress tests, measuring vital signs with medical equipment, and providing hands-on rehabilitative care. While AI can highly automate the digital aspects of the job—such as analyzing medical history, processing biometric data, and generating personalized exercise regimens—the core requirement for real-time human interaction, physical assessment, and clinical supervision in a medical setting limits its total exposure.
